Assignment
Transferring contract rights to another party, without release from liability
The assignor hands over their rights but generally remains secondarily liable if the assignee fails to perform. Many contracts and most leases restrict assignment or require the other party’s consent.
How the exam asks about it
The lingering liability is the examinable point, and it is why a departing tenant who assigns a lease is often unpleasantly surprised.
